Thrustful India thrash China for a fluent 9-0 win

Indian relished weak challenge offered by China and pumped in nine goals to nil to post an emphatic 9-0 win in their penultimate pool match of the 4th Asian Champions Trophy in Kuantan.

Akashdeep Singh set the goal scroll moving in the ninth minute which was followed by Affan Yousaf ten minutes later. Affan was again in the scoring act in the 40th minute.

Rupinder converted India’s first PC in the 25th minute (4-0).

Inbetween defender Jasjit Singh, who played upfront today, gave a finishing touches to combined attack generated by the duo of Akashdeep and Talwinder (3-0). His forehand from top of the circle elicited no response from China goalie Zhiwei Ao.

Despite a goal disallowed on China’s referral, India sat comfortably at halftime with a 4-0 score. Rupinder’s conversion was disallowed on referral.

Thimmaiah tore the Chinese defence with a fast counter and his reverse found the net in the 34th minute (5-0).

Three minutes, continuing the momentum, Lalit Upadhyay, who just come in, punched in a melee (6-0).

Catching a defender blind, Akashdeep Singh stole the ball upfront and moved to centre of D to whack his second goal in the 39th minute (7-0).

Nine minutes before the hooter, Jasjit Singh got a minus from Pardeep Mor after two earlier shots were blocked by the rival goalie, whacked to the left of the cage (9-0).

India got its third PC, but the ball was not stopped properly for Rupinder to add to his personal tally.

Earlier, his goal off the second PC was given by the umpire but it did not survive Chinese referral.

India, unsually, worked hard even after nine goals but the Chinese did not yield. Perhaps, India eyeing topping the pool with goal average, which is a possibility.

India will take on Malaysia tomorrow (18 hrs IST). Malaysia is sitting pretty well with 9 points after 3 matches. India now has ten points after four matches.
